美文网首页
Elisp一天一函数—— cond

Elisp一天一函数—— cond

作者: m2fox | 来源:发表于2019-01-17 13:36 被阅读0次
    • 函数名称:cond
    • 函数原型:(cond CLAUSES...)
    • 函数功能一句话描述:条件分支,相当于其他编程语言的switch-case语句。
    • 函数用法demo:
      下面实现把百分制分数转换为等级的功能:
    (setq score 89)
    (cond
     ((< score 60) (message "D"))
     ((and (>= score 60) (< score 80)) (message "C"))
     ((and (>= score 80) (< score 90)) (message "B"))
     ((> score 90) (message "A")))
    

    运行上述代码,输出:

    B
    

    相关文章

      网友评论

          本文标题:Elisp一天一函数—— cond

          本文链接:https://www.haomeiwen.com/subject/ovhidqtx.html